SMELL

I have a trait - a tendency - an O.C.D. - that makes me smell books. I know it’s weird. But it’s like I have to. I get a new book - or a used one - or a borrowed one from the library - and I automatically open it and put it to my nose and smell it. I know you have now lost several levels of respect for me and I don’t know why I do it, but I do.

I’ve passed this awesome gift to at least two of my adult children, by the way. And chances are at least 10% of you do it too (according to irrefutable research). Don’t pretend you don’t know what I’m talking about.

It’s one of the big reasons I miss hymnals in church. They had that odd bouquet blend of old yellowed paper with slight undertones of hand sweat. Yum, huh?

But honestly, I miss that church smell. Words to worship choruses splashed on big video screens don’t have a smell. I’ve never gone home saying, ‘Boy, that “HOW GREAT IS OUR GOD”’ really smelled great today.’

When I get rich and famous, please know that I will create a cologne and perfume that smells like old hymnals. If guys want to meet a great Christian girl, they can splash some on. Girls can wear it if they want to attract a pastor.

I’m going to bring my own hymnal some Sunday morning and sniff it to my heart’s content while everyone around me is singing. Sounds like a great time to me.
